Ikaruga is one of those games where no matter how many time's you die, no matter how many profanities you scream at the XBox, you'll still want to go back to it.

It's another of those classic vertical scrolling shooters that you see a lot ofd on the XBox arcade, but this is just so much better!
You have the ability to switch polarity's between black and white. This allows you to absorb enemy bullets that are the same colour as you (filling up a power bar to release a smart bomb) and allowing you to do double damage to the opposite coloured ships.

The game becomes a frantic desperation to switch polarity's every second to basicaly fly through incoming fire that is virtualy impossible to avoid otherwise.

The 5 levels are rather challenging, with the end bosses looking great andf very enjoyable to fight.

The 12 achievements are great fun to go after to, and make you feel like you've earned them.
You get one for finishing each level, and one for finishing the game without using a continue (damned hard!) there's also one for getting through a level without firing, just absorbing your way through. Theres 5 for completing each mission with an A or above rank - which is just damned-right impossible!

An A rank means chaining (hitting 3 ships of the same colour) repeatedly and not getting hit at all.
The leaderboard allows you to download peoples replays (show off!),. and when you watch these people who have spent hours memorizing where everything will come you see just how much time people devote to this.
